DPMC is all about ensuring New Zealand is ambitious, resilient and well-governed, so naturally we’re involved in a wide range of work.

Our vacancies

 

This includes:

  • providing free and frank advice to the Prime Minister on constitutional issues
  • providing policy advice to the Prime Minister and Cabinet on a wide range of complex issues and supporting the operation of Cabinet and Cabinet Committees 
  • ensuring advice across agencies and entities is coherent and takes account of all relevant viewpoints
  • coordinating emergency management responses in a major disaster
  • dealing with national security threats and advising on cyber security
  • leading and coordinating central government’s role on the regeneration of Christchurch
  • managing public sector performance, alongside SSC and the Treasury
  • providing support services for the Governor-General
